From nobody Fri Jul 30 09:29:38 2021 X-Original-To: freebsd-hackers@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 1BC9C12DD7E1; Fri, 30 Jul 2021 09:29:50 +0000 (UTC) (envelope-from bu7cher@yandex.ru) Received: from forward103p.mail.yandex.net (forward103p.mail.yandex.net [77.88.28.106]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(Client did not present a certificate) by mx1.freebsd.org (Postfix) with ESMTPS id 4Gbhv05mTCz4W5D; Fri, 30 Jul 2021 09:29:48 +0000 (UTC) (envelope-from bu7cher@yandex.ru) Received: from myt6-61e9e731de9c.qloud-c.yandex.net (myt6-61e9e731de9c.qloud-c.yandex.net [IPv6:2a02:6b8:c12:4ca0:0:640:61e9:e731]) by forward103p.mail.yandex.net (Yandex) with ESMTP id 69DBA18C24FF; Fri, 30 Jul 2021 12:29:39 +0300 (MSK) Received: from myt6-efff10c3476a.qloud-c.yandex.net (myt6-efff10c3476a.qloud-c.yandex.net [2a02:6b8:c12:13a3:0:640:efff:10c3]) by myt6-61e9e731de9c.qloud-c.yandex.net (mxback/Yandex) with ESMTP id YcvVnDnjD4-TdIi9foP; Fri, 30 Jul 2021 12:29:39 +0300 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=yandex.ru; s=mail; t=1627637379; bh=ZrQ+nhe/ueOOQod26S1KHNJ2GeDQaGIV9dteVMDtBVk=; h=In-Reply-To:References:Date:Message-ID:From:To:Subject; b=KpnGc4rKzLL30KWOSJpt5GtZdIuxYm9qpaV5OwVSP7Ittj9mgKhH6JtRZQnMAn1AK RNCSxnK6UvqY2UFpEiMyO+Lg7Beys4CUFN6+I2hHukM1oezhHDHOE/Q3y+7TE5q0os AhbktRHyrzOIFCKYG5yGn55DFKjoCxzGR+plress= Received: by myt6-efff10c3476a.qloud-c.yandex.net (smtp/Yandex) with ESMTPSA id IY9LeMDmdS-Tc3KfkDi; Fri, 30 Jul 2021 12:29:39 +0300 (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its)) (Client certificate not present) Subject: Re: is there a way to Port DragonflyBSD's IPFW3 to FreeBSD To: alfadev , "freebsd-hackers@FreeBSD.org" , "freebsd-ipfw@FreeBSD.org" References: From: "Andrey V. Elsukov" Message-ID: Date: Fri, 30 Jul 2021 12:29:38 +0300 User-Agent: Mozilla/5.0 (X11; FreeBSD amd64; rv:78.0) Gecko/20100101 Thunderbird/78.11.0 List-Id: Technical discussions relating to FreeBSD List-Archive: https://lists.freebsd.org/archives/freebsd-hackers List-Help: List-Post: List-Subscribe: List-Unsubscribe: Sender: owner-freebsd-hackers@freebsd.org MIME-Version: 1.0 In-Reply-To: Content-Type: multipart/signed; micalg=pgp-sha256; protocol="application/pgp-signature"; boundary="NXyMaoWD3kZjbmiA7PmuA0M0b77oMGPVT" X-Rspamd-Queue-Id: 4Gbhv05mTCz4W5D X-Spamd-Bar: ------ Authentication-Results: mx1.freebsd.org; dkim=pass header.d=yandex.ru header.s=mail header.b=KpnGc4rK; dmarc=pass (policy=none) header.from=yandex.ru; spf=pass (mx1.freebsd.org: domain of bu7cher@yandex.ru designates 77.88.28.106 as permitted sender) smtp.mailfrom=bu7cher@yandex.ru X-Spamd-Result: default: False [-6.10 / 15.00]; TO_DN_EQ_ADDR_SOME(0.00)[]; RCVD_VIA_SMTP_AUTH(0.00)[]; TO_DN_SOME(0.00)[]; FREEMAIL_FROM(0.00)[yandex.ru]; R_SPF_ALLOW(-0.20)[+ip4:77.88.0.0/18]; HAS_ATTACHMENT(0.00)[]; RCVD_COUNT_THREE(0.00)[4]; DKIM_TRACE(0.00)[yandex.ru:+]; DMARC_POLICY_ALLOW(-0.50)[yandex.ru,none]; NEURAL_HAM_SHORT(-1.00)[-1.000]; SIGNED_PGP(-2.00)[]; FREEMAIL_TO(0.00)[protonmail.com,FreeBSD.org]; FROM_EQ_ENVFROM(0.00)[]; RCVD_TLS_LAST(0.00)[]; MIME_TRACE(0.00)[0:+,1:+,2:+,3:~]; FREEMAIL_ENVFROM(0.00)[yandex.ru]; MID_RHS_MATCH_FROM(0.00)[]; ASN(0.00)[asn:13238, ipnet:77.88.0.0/18, country:RU]; ARC_NA(0.00)[]; NEURAL_HAM_MEDIUM(-1.00)[-1.000]; R_DKIM_ALLOW(-0.20)[yandex.ru:s=mail]; FROM_HAS_DN(0.00)[]; RCPT_COUNT_THREE(0.00)[3]; NEURAL_HAM_LONG(-1.00)[-1.000]; MIME_GOOD(-0.20)[multipart/signed,multipart/mixed,text/plain]; DWL_DNSWL_NONE(0.00)[yandex.ru:dkim]; TO_MATCH_ENVRCPT_SOME(0.00)[]; RWL_MAILSPIKE_POSSIBLE(0.00)[77.88.28.106:from]; MAILMAN_DEST(0.00)[freebsd-hackers,freebsd-ipfw] X-ThisMailContainsUnwantedMimeParts: N This is an OpenPGP/MIME signed message (RFC 4880 and 3156) --NXyMaoWD3kZjbmiA7PmuA0M0b77oMGPVT Content-Type: multipart/mixed; boundary="dnUbK2ktay7uPmN1ddWZTYtGuEFHHz6bn"; protected-headers="v1" From: "Andrey V. Elsukov" To: alfadev , "freebsd-hackers@FreeBSD.org" , "freebsd-ipfw@FreeBSD.org" Message-ID: Subject: Re: is there a way to Port DragonflyBSD's IPFW3 to FreeBSD References: In-Reply-To: --dnUbK2ktay7uPmN1ddWZTYtGuEFHHz6bn Content-Type: text/plain; charset=utf-8 Content-Language: en-US Content-Transfer-Encoding: quoted-printable 28.07.2021 16:05, alfadev via freebsd-hackers =D0=BF=D0=B8=D1=88=D0=B5=D1= =82: > These are some hard problems to me when i try to completely move on > IPFW. So is there a way to port IPFW3 to FreeBSD. Thanks for any help > and suggestions.. I think it is much easier just implement needed functional in the FreeBSD's ipfw, than doing porting ipfw from DragonFly. But you can try := ) --=20 WBR, Andrey V. Elsukov --dnUbK2ktay7uPmN1ddWZTYtGuEFHHz6bn-- --NXyMaoWD3kZjbmiA7PmuA0M0b77oMGPVT Content-Type: application/pgp-signature; name="OpenPGP_signature.asc" Content-Description: OpenPGP digital signature Content-Disposition: attachment; filename="OpenPGP_signature" -----BEGIN PGP SIGNATURE----- wsB5BAABCAAjFiEE5lkeG0HaFRbwybwAAcXqBBDIoXoFAmEDxoIFAwAAAAAACgkQAcXqBBDIoXo+ cQgAkPq06UI152pF074j6OTPFGDPt7SnoqstDYz+6bQQpnBRc4sUDXSGZmIl6SekwfA0fzGA2YCM pIbz5u1qlEdILbSATQTgMKHFQoR/GYx4AqmZ6cB4kCSrUSHqiesA4nA8NJ9fp8eCB49hWxM6rllM J/aw80uqVLrcP+3i3wDuGIn37Ex2eih/12Ph6jvgqULkIuaCEMfJDDPUOPLRxIP64FcbErRu7qlq BFECIIxjLWz9O6XUL9ToTEDPUQtRS6HaMdN1j+iK5LVTyjn+R/+wrFFL/KvVcIcXP497dpXZgvDn h+MRz3ku+G1UG+Pc+rFVo4eZUboGHTP3oKRD5dNA7w== =dSeM -----END PGP SIGNATURE----- --NXyMaoWD3kZjbmiA7PmuA0M0b77oMGPVT--